find y-intercept and x-intercept.
2x+3y=6

Answer:

x intercept is (3, 0)

y intercept is (0, 2)

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the intercepts of a standard form equation, remove the other term and solve for the variable:

remove the y:

2x = 6

x = 3

remove the x:

3y = 6

y = 2

x intercept is (3, 0)

y intercept is (0, 2)
